//
// Implement this structure to handle events when window rendering is disabled.
// The functions of this structure will be called on the UI thread.
//
#[repr(C)]
pub struct _cef_render_handler_t {
//
// Base structure.
//
pub base: types::cef_base_t,
//
// Called to retrieve the root window rectangle in screen coordinates. Return
// true (1) if the rectangle was provided.
//
pub get_root_screen_rect: Option<extern "C" fn(
this: *mut cef_render_handler_t, brow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
rect: *mut types::cef_rect_t) -> libc::c_int>,
//
// Called to retrieve the view rectangle which is relative to screen
// coordinates. Return true (1) if the rectangle was provided.
//
pub get_view_rect: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
rect: *mut types::cef_rect_t) -> libc::c_int>,
//
// Called to retrieve the translation from view coordinates to actual screen
// coordinates. Return true (1) if the screen coordinates were provided.
//
pub get_screen_point: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t, viewX: libc::c_int,
viewY: libc::c_int, screenX: *mut libc::c_int,
screenY: *mut libc::c_int) -> libc::c_int>,
//
// Called to allow the client to fill in the CefScreenInfo object with
// appropriate values. Return true (1) if the |screen_info| structure has been
// modified.
//
// If the screen info rectangle is left NULL the rectangle from GetViewRect
// will be used. If the rectangle is still NULL or invalid popups may not be
// drawn correctly.
//
pub get_screen_info: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
screen_info: *mut interfaces::cef_screen_info_t) -> libc::c_int>,
//
// Called when the browser wants to show or hide the popup widget. The popup
// should be shown if |show| is true (1) and hidden if |show| is false (0).
//
pub on_popup_show: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t, show: libc::c_int) -> ()>,
//
// Called when the browser wants to move or resize the popup widget. |rect|
// contains the new location and size in view coordinates.
//
pub on_popup_size: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
rect: *const types::cef_rect_t) -> ()>,
//
// Called when an element should be painted. Pixel values passed to this
// function are scaled relative to view coordinates based on the value of
// CefScreenInfo.device_scale_factor returned from GetScreenInfo. |type|
// indicates whether the element is the view or the popup widget. |buffer|
// contains the pixel data for the whole image. |dirtyRects| contains the set
// of rectangles in pixel coordinates that need to be repainted. |buffer| will
// be |width|*|height|*4 bytes in size and represents a BGRA image with an
// upper-left origin.
//
pub on_paint: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
ty: types::cef_paint_element_type_t, dirtyRects_count: libc::size_t,
dirtyRects: *const types::cef_rect_t, buffer: *const (),
width: libc::c_int, height: libc::c_int) -> ()>,
//
// Called when the browser's cursor has changed. If |type| is CT_CUSTOM then
// |custom_cursor_info| will be populated with the custom cursor information.
//
pub on_cursor_change: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
cursor: types::cef_cursor_handle_t, ty: types::cef_cursor_type_t,
custom_cursor_info: *const interfaces::cef_cursor_info_t) -> ()>,
//
// Called when the user starts dragging content in the web view. Contextual
// information about the dragged content is supplied by |drag_data|. (|x|,
// |y|) is the drag start location in screen coordinates. OS APIs that run a
// system message loop may be used within the StartDragging call.
//
// Return false (0) to abort the drag operation. Don't call any of
// cef_browser_host_t::DragSource*Ended* functions after returning false (0).
//
// Return true (1) to handle the drag operation. Call
// cef_browser_host_t::DragSourceEndedAt and DragSourceSystemDragEnded either
// synchronously or asynchronously to inform the web view that the drag
// operation has ended.
//
pub start_dragging: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
drag_data: *mut interfaces::cef_drag_data_t,
allowed_ops: types::cef_drag_operations_mask_t, x: libc::c_int,
y: libc::c_int) -> libc::c_int>,
//
// Called when the web view wants to update the mouse cursor during a drag &
// drop operation. |operation| describes the allowed operation (none, move,
// copy, link).
//
pub update_drag_cursor: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
operation: types::cef_drag_operations_mask_t) -> ()>,
//
// Called when the scroll offset has changed.
//
pub on_scroll_offset_changed: Option<extern "C" fn(
this: *mut cef_render_handler_t, brow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
x: libc::c_double, y: libc::c_double) -> ()>,
//
// Called to retrieve the backing size of the view rectangle which is relative
// to screen coordinates. On HiDPI displays, the backing size can differ from
// the view size as returned by |GetViewRect|. Return true (1) if the
// rectangle was provided. Only used on Mac OS.
//
pub get_backing_rect: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t,
rect: *mut types::cef_rect_t) -> libc::c_int>,
//
// Called when an element should be presented (e.g. double buffers should page
// flip). This is called only during accelerated compositing.
//
pub on_present: Option<extern "C" fn(this: *mut cef_render_handler_t,
browser: *mut interfaces::cef_browser_t) -> ()>,
//
// The reference count. This will only be present for Rust instances!
//
pub ref_count: u32,
//
// Extra data. This will only be present for Rust instances!
//
pub extra: u8,
}
pub type cef_render_handler_t = _cef_render_handler_t;
